Re: Looking for dummy engine for cox dragster
They are probably the rarest part for the cox eliminator dragsters. They pop up on eBay from time to time, a nos one was listed a few weeks back but went for somewhere around the 100 mark from memory. if you can't find one here just keep trolling eBay using "cox eliminator" "cox dragster" and "cox parts" as separate searches. I needed one and ended up buying an almost complete car just to get the dummy engine.
